Trinidad and Tobago - Import of Petroleum Jelly

Since 2014, Trinidad and Tobago Import of Petroleum Jelly was down by 7% year on year. With $325,734 in 2019, the country was ranked number 92 comparing other countries in Import of Petroleum Jelly. Trinidad and Tobago is overtaken by Bulgaria, which was number 91 at $337,536.16 and is followed by Finland with $320,078.24. Nigeria lead the ranking with $51,411,499.31 in 2019, that is a fall of 5.7% versus 2018. Japan, Canada and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ands witnessed the best average annual growth at +125% per year, while Maldives was the worst growing country at -64.9% per year.
